sumif函数是单和函数,不是排序函数。如果你需要使用排序,你需要配合其他功能。
方法/步骤
1/10
打开exc
代码示例:
降序排列:
#包含stdio.h
主()
{
inta[4]{1,4,2,6};
inti,j,num
for(i1;i4;我)
{
for(j0;j4-i;j)
{if(a[j]a[j1])
numa[j];a[j]a[j1];a[j1]num;}
}
}
for(i0;i4;我)
printf(d,a[i]);
}
升序排列:
#包含stdio.h
主()
{
inta[4]{1,4,2,6};
inti,j,num
for(i1;i4;我)
{
for(j0;j4-i;j)
{if(a[j]a[j1])
numa[j];a[j]a[j1];a[j1]num;}
}
}
for(i0;i4;我)
printf(d,a[i]);
}
用秩函数降序排列的步骤如下::。
1.首先,找到要按降序排序的表。在这里,你要按照工资的降序,也就是从高到低。
2.点击排名的空白单元格,然后点击功能。
3.点击后,找到rank函数。
4.按数值选择以前的薪资,然后参照查找所有薪资金额。方法是0,是降序。
如下所示:
#包含ltstdio.hgt
voidsort(intlen,int*a)
{
if(len1)返回
for(inti0iltlen-1i){
if(*(ai)lt*(ai1)){
inttmp*(ai1)
*(人工智能1)*(人工智能)
*(ai)tmp
}
}
排序(len-1,a)
}
intmain()
{
intcount,a[20]
scanf(#34%d#34,ampcount)//输入数组的数量。
for(inti0iltcounti){
scanf(#34%d#34,ampa[i])
}
排序(计数,a)
for(inti0iltcounti){
printf(#34%d#34,a[i])
}
返回0
}